Strengthen Clinical Documentation With a Behavioral Health EHR
Behavioral healthcare generates extensive clinical information throughout treatment. Assessments, diagnoses, treatment plans, progress notes, interventions, medication information, outcome measures, care coordination, and discharge documentation all contribute to the patient’s longitudinal record.
A specialized Behavioral Health EHR can organize this information around behavioral health workflows. Providers in Highland can document encounters and access relevant information according to authorized roles.
A Mental Health EHR can also support multidisciplinary teams that include therapists, counselors, psychiatrists, psychologists, case managers, and other behavioral health professionals.
When clinical documentation is connected with scheduling and practice management, organizations can reduce duplicate data entry and improve continuity between administrative and clinical workflows.

Improve Behavioral Health Billing and Revenue Cycle Management
Behavioral health financial performance depends on several interconnected processes. Eligibility, authorization, documentation, coding, claims submission, payment posting, denial management, and accounts receivable can all influence reimbursement.
Behavioral Health Billing Software can connect financial workflows with patient, appointment, and encounter information. This gives billing teams greater context when reviewing claims and payment activity.
Behavioral Health Revenue Cycle Management provides visibility across the financial lifecycle, from eligibility and authorization through claims, payments, denials, and outstanding balances.
Organizations with multiple providers, programs, or facilities can review financial performance by service, program, provider, or location while maintaining a broader view across Highland, Virginia, and VA.

Find Revenue Problems Earlier in the Process
Reimbursement problems can begin before a claim reaches a payer. Eligibility errors, missing authorizations, incomplete documentation, coding issues, and delayed submissions can all contribute to payment delays.
Connecting billing with scheduling and clinical information can give financial teams additional context when reviewing denials, delayed claims, and accounts receivable.
Organizations across Highland can use this visibility to identify recurring issues and prioritize workflow changes that may improve revenue cycle efficiency.
